Mark Turner

Mark Turner is a cognitive scientist and linguist known for his work on how humans understand language and thought. He explores how our minds use mental schemas—structured patterns of knowledge—to interpret stories, concepts, and conversations. Turner's research highlights the connection between language and cognition, showing that we use mental frameworks to make sense of the world and communicate effectively. His insights help explain how language shapes our understanding and how we organize knowledge mentally, bridging the fields of linguistics, psychology, and neuroscience.
